The 2022 CSX system-wide train efficiency metric, as shown above, equals approximately 520 ton-miles per gallon. In other words, CSX trains, on average, can move a ton of freight nearly 520 miles on a gallon of fuel, based on our 2022 revenue ton miles and 2022 fuel use. The fuel efficiency for a freight truck can be estimated in a similar way.

U.S. freight railroads, on average, move one ton of freight nearly 500 miles per gallon of fuel. On average, railroads are three to four times more fuel efficient than trucks. That means moving freight by rail instead of trucks lowers greenhouse gas emissions by up to 75%, on average. • Reducing Highway Congestion:Trucks have cost advantages for shorter distances (less than 250 to 500 miles) and function primarily as the short-haul mode between farm and local silos. ... often less than half of rail’s per ton-mile cost. Railroads move roughly 40% of long-distance freight volume (measured by ton-miles) in the United States. Despite the large volume of freight moved, U.S. EPA data show freight railroads only account for 0.5% of total U.S. greenhouse gas emissions and just 1.7% of emissions from transportation-related sources.
